Web16 nov. 2024 · How It Works. The present method for smelting lead sulfide concentrates to produce lead is a pyrometallurgical smelting method that requires temperatures as high as 1,400 °C. Such smelting methods result in high lead and sulfur dioxide emissions. These high-temperature smelting operations will be unable to meet proposed emission standards. WebLead is chiefly obtained from the mineral galena by a roasting process. At least 40% of lead in the UK is recycled from secondary sources such as scrap batteries and pipes. …

http://www.madehow.com/Volume-2/Lead.html WebIn deposits mined today, lead is usually found in ore which also contains zinc, silver and commonly copper and is extracted as a co-product of these metals. However, more than half of the lead we use comes from recycling, mostly from old car batteries.
